Beyond general fluency, I've seen specific initiatives, particularly in places like New Zealand, offering government-certified, free English courses. These are designed with real life in mind, catering to residents and citizens who might be juggling work, family, or simply haven't used their English in a while. The beauty here is the flexibility – online Zoom classes mean you can learn from the comfort of your home, no matter where you are in the country. And getting an official certificate from a recognized body like NZQA? That's a significant boost for job applications, further studies, or even citizenship processes.
